I guess for me it just doesn't make sense to get ARP wheel studs when all that same torque is passing through the little tiny hub studs. Those are on a smaller diameter, and they are MUCH smaller studs.

We aren't interested in Wheel studs for the strength of the stud in relation to torque being transmited, its so that the threads on the studs stop getting all gummed up from taking the wheel on and off. Not to mention having a longer stud which would allow more thread to be used and would add more clampping force.
